California SB 1289 (20232024) — Medi-Cal: call centers: standards and data.

Existing law establishes the Medi-Cal program, which is administered by the State Department of Health Care Services and under which qualified low-income individuals receive health care services. The Medi-Cal program is, in part, governed and funded by federal Medicaid program provisions. Existing law sets forth various responsibilities for counties relating to eligibility determinations and enrollment functions under the Medi-Cal program.

Timeline

The legislative action history — every referral, reading, and vote.

  • 2024-02-15 Introduced. Read first time. To Com. on RLS. for assignment. To print. introduction, reading-1
  • 2024-02-16 From printer. May be acted upon on or after March 17.
  • 2024-02-29 Referred to Com. on RLS. referral-committee
  • 2024-03-18 From committee with author's amendments. Read second time and amended. Re-referred to Com. on RLS. amendment-passage, committee-passage, reading-1, reading-2, referral-committee
  • 2024-04-03 Re-referred to Com. on HEALTH. referral-committee
  • 2024-04-05 Set for hearing April 24.
  • 2024-04-08 From committee with author's amendments. Read second time and amended. Re-referred to Com. on HEALTH. amendment-passage, committee-passage, reading-1, reading-2, referral-committee
  • 2024-04-25 From committee: Do pass as amended and re-refer to Com. on APPR. (Ayes 11. Noes 0. Page 3756.) (April 24). amendment-passage, committee-passage, committee-passage-favorable
  • 2024-04-29 Read second time and amended. Re-referred to Com. on APPR. amendment-passage, reading-1, reading-2, referral-committee
  • 2024-04-30 Set for hearing May 6.
  • 2024-05-06 May 6 hearing: Placed on APPR suspense file.
  • 2024-05-10 Set for hearing May 16.
  • 2024-05-16 From committee: Do pass. (Ayes 7. Noes 0. Page 3978.) (May 16). committee-passage, committee-passage-favorable
  • 2024-05-16 Read second time. Ordered to third reading. reading-1, reading-2
  • 2024-05-21 Read third time. Passed. (Ayes 39. Noes 0. Page 4066.) Ordered to the Assembly. passage, reading-1, reading-3
  • 2024-05-22 In Assembly. Read first time. Held at Desk. reading-1
  • 2024-05-28 Referred to Com. on HEALTH. referral-committee
  • 2024-06-05 From committee: Do pass as amended and re-refer to Com. on APPR. (Ayes 15. Noes 0.) (June 4). amendment-passage, committee-passage, committee-passage-favorable
  • 2024-06-06 Read second time and amended. Re-referred to Com. on APPR. amendment-passage, reading-1, reading-2, referral-committee
  • 2024-07-02 July 2 set for first hearing. Placed on suspense file.
  • 2024-08-15 From committee: Do pass as amended. (Ayes 11. Noes 0.) (August 15). amendment-passage, committee-passage, committee-passage-favorable
  • 2024-08-19 Read second time and amended. Ordered to second reading. amendment-passage, reading-1, reading-2
  • 2024-08-20 Read second time. Ordered to third reading. reading-1, reading-2
  • 2024-08-27 Read third time. Passed. (Ayes 76. Noes 0. Page 6655.) Ordered to the Senate. passage, reading-1, reading-3
  • 2024-08-28 In Senate. Concurrence in Assembly amendments pending.
  • 2024-08-28 Assembly amendments concurred in. (Ayes 39. Noes 0. Page 5589.) Ordered to engrossing and enrolling. amendment-passage, committee-passage-favorable
  • 2024-09-04 Enrolled and presented to the Governor at 4 p.m.
  • 2024-09-27 Approved by the Governor. executive-signature
  • 2024-09-27 Chaptered by Secretary of State. Chapter 792, Statutes of 2024. became-law
